A prisoner in an Asturias jail was found dead in his cell yesterday morning and was taken to the morgue pending a post mortem.
Trouble is, Gonzalo Montoya Jiménez wasn’t dead and neither was it a clever escape plan. He was on a table in the morgue awaiting an autopsy when they noticed that the sheet covering the body was moving – and that the ‘corpse’ was snoring.
He was immediately rushed to the nearest hospital where, although his condition is described as serious, doctors say he is recovering.
It’s not a case of a single doctor’s mistake, because three doctors certified that he was dead: the doctor on night duty, the prison doctor the next day, and then the coroner.
